Do you know how long it takes to build a habit? Around 18 days. And this figure falls even lower when drugs are involved.
Numerous studies have proven time and again that alcohol and drug abuse can affect your health and brain drastically, influencing your thought process and behavior as well. What often starts as a one-off trial, leads to a continuous use and addiction. With passing time, the doses start getting higher and that is when it becomes difficult to get rid of the habit.
In Ohio, the sales of marijuana are expected to reach approximately USD 1.3 billion 4 years from now. And that figure is only for marijuana. The figures would go much higher if other drugs, alcohol, and nicotine, were to be considered. Further, more than 4,000 deaths in Ohio were caused by drug overdose 2 years ago, alone. Most of the state’s drugs come from traffickers from Mexico and the Southwest border states.
However, help is not too far and you do not need to go through it alone. There are a number of drug and alcohol addiction centers in Ohio that can help you on your addiction recovery journey.
4 years ago, a record 4,854 overdose deaths took place after the synthetic opioid carfentanil flooded the state. Over the past few months, around 7.87% of Ohio residents have been reported to be using illegal drugs. Cocaine, meth, and heroin are other commonly used drugs in Ohio. A large number of the state’s addiction rehab centers are tailored around rehabilitation from cocaine and heroin addiction.
Many avoid going into rehab as they believe that it is better to be at home during the process. However, that is not the way to deal with the situation. Picking a certified rehab center ensures that you have access to highly skilled professionals who are familiar with different kinds of circumstances.
This is where inpatient drug rehabs come in. They offer a comprehensive set of facilities that are best suited for your situation and needs. They also provide a 24/7 support system and supervision from a skilled and experienced crew.
The main objective of inpatient drug rehab centers is to ensure that they rid the drugs from the patient's system - both physically and psychologically before they are allowed to leave the facility.
Alcohol is another major cause of death in Ohio. 4 years ago, 2.6 people out of every 100,000 have died because of alcohol-related issues.
Teenagers and adolescents are more likely to fall prey to alcohol addiction. They also tend to consume alcohol with opioid - a dangerous combination, which increases the chances of death.
Drinking and driving is another major cause of death in the state. As of 4 years ago, there were 379 deaths caused by driving vehicles under the influence of alcohol.
Ohio has a vast number of rehab centers for alcohol addicts, to ensure they live a healthy lifestyle. You can choose your rehabilitation center and treatment program based on your requirements, while also consulting with your family members, mentors, or professionals.
Here are some factors to consider while choosing a treatment program:
Rehabilitation services provided: Start with deciding your rehabilitation goals and then look for centers that meet these goals. Check whether they provide the services you need based on your particular condition and goals.
Treatment approach: There are many different kinds of therapies and treatment options on offer. This could be Cognitive Behavioral Therapy, Psychoanalysis, Dialectical behavior therapy, Supportive therapy, etc.
Any special needs/demographic: There are alcohol use rehabs that cater to people with special needs, or in case you have a particular condition for which you need extra care. There are also facilities that cater specifically to people of certain demographics - teens and adolescents or senior citizens, for example.
Cost: An important factor while deciding, it completely depends on your budget and payment options offered by the center. Some alcohol abuse treatment centers in Ohio accept insurance, while others allow you to pay on a sliding scale.
The cost of rehab centers can vary based on different aspects such as treatment type, center type, amenities, etc. Inpatient rehab generally costs around $6,000 for a 30-day service. However, a top-rated drug/alcohol rehab can charge around $12,000 for the same.
The kind of medications you are on will also affect the cost. For instance, if you are going for an alcohol abuse treatment, you may need medications for it.
